Abstract
A decoder for a video signal encoded according to the MPEG-2 standard includes a single high-bandwidth memory and a digital phase-locked loop. This memory has a single memory port. The memory is used to hold 1) the input bit-stream, 2) first and second reference frames used for motion compensated processing, and 3) image data representing a field that is currently being decoded. The decoder includes circuitry which stores and fetches the bit-stream data, fetches the reference frame data, stores the image data for the field that is currently being decoded in block format and fetches this image data for conversion to raster-scan format. All of these memory access operations are time division multiplexed and use the single memory port. The digital phase locked loop (DPLL) counts pulses of a 27 MHz system clock signal, defined in the MPEG-2 standard, to generate a count value. The count value is compared to a succession of externally supplied system clock reference (SCR) values to generate a phase difference signal that is used to adjust the frequency of the signal produced by the DPLL.
